New Home Communities in Enoch UT: A City Built for the Way People Actually Want to Live

Enoch sits at an elevation of approximately 5,400 feet, which gives it a noticeably different climate character than the communities lower in the St. George valley. Summers are warm but more moderate, winters bring occasional snow that makes the landscape genuinely beautiful without the severity of higher-elevation Utah communities, and the overall four-season character of the weather here gives residents a relationship with the natural calendar that many people from warmer climates find deeply satisfying.

The city is growing, but it is growing deliberately. Development in Enoch has tended toward larger lots, more generous setbacks, and a residential density that preserves the open, uncongested character that defines the community’s appeal. Streets feel unhurried. Neighborhoods have room to breathe. And the night sky — uncompromised by the light pollution that affects more densely developed areas — is a reminder of what the broader landscape was like before metropolitan growth arrived.

Cedar City, just a few miles north, adds significant practical depth to Enoch’s appeal. Southern Utah University is located in Cedar City, bringing educational resources, cultural programming, and economic activity to the immediate area. Cedar City Regional Airport connects residents to Salt Lake City and beyond. The Utah Shakespeare Festival, held annually in Cedar City, draws visitors from across the country and contributes to a cultural vitality that Enoch residents enjoy as neighbors rather than tourists.

For buyers who need access to the St. George metro, the I-15 corridor makes the drive manageable — and many Enoch residents who work in Cedar City or from home find that the distance from the busier parts of the region is not a concession but a genuine quality-of-life benefit.

Pine View Estates: Seabright Homes’ Enoch Community at Its Finest

Seabright Homes’ flagship community in Enoch is Pine View Estates — a development that reflects both the character of the city and the full depth of what quality new construction can offer buyers at this stage of their homebuying journey.

Pine View Estates offers homes ranging from approximately 1,400 to 3,000 square feet across configurations of three to six bedrooms and two to four bathrooms, with pricing starting in the mid-$390,000s and ranging to approximately $600,000. That range is intentional — it allows the community to serve buyers at different points in their financial journey without anchoring the neighborhood to a single buyer profile.

Two and three-car garage configurations are available, and the community features RV garage options for buyers who want to keep their recreational vehicles on-site without sacrificing the organization and function of their primary garage space. Casita options are also available, providing a separate living area that adds genuine flexibility for multigenerational households, frequent visitors, or buyers who want the option of a home-based rental income stream.
